You would have to >> check with the DNS ISP to find out if it has changed or not. > > OK, there seems to be some confusion about how DNS works and what the TTL > value does, and what lookups report. Dennis has sort of covered some of this, > but it might help to see the whole process. > > When you do a lookup for a name, your client asks the locally configured > resolver the question - eg what is the TXT record for current.cvd.clamav.net. > > Assuming the resolver has nothing in the cache, then it will go to the root > servers and ask the same question. The root servers won't know, so they will > reply to the effect of "I don't know, but the name servers <list of servers> > have a better answer" - ie the name servers for .net > So your resolver goes and asks the same question of one or more of those > servers. They'll get the same "I don't know, but ..." answer, this time with > a list of name servers handling clamav.net. > The resolver will continue in this manner until it reaches far enough down > the tree to get find a server that knows the answer. In this case, the > nameservers for clamav.net (ns[2-7].clamav.net here*) know the answer and > will return it. > > Using DIG, this is the chain of results, note that when using +trace, DIG > deliberately ignores cached records and so the TTL values are those of the > records as served by the relevant name server (except for the root servers > which I assume it still uses the local resolver cache for - it has to start > somewhere !) : > > $ dig +trace current.cvd.clamav.net txt > > ; <<>> DiG 9.8.4-rpz2+rl005.12-P1 <<>> +trace current.cvd.clamav.net txt > ;; global options: +cmd > . 45003 IN NS h.root-servers.net. > . 45003 IN NS b.root-servers.net. > . 45003 IN NS l.root-servers.net. > . 45003 IN NS e.root-servers.net. > . 45003 IN NS g.root-servers.net. > . 45003 IN NS m.root-servers.net. > . 45003 IN NS j.root-servers.net. > . 45003 IN NS c.root-servers.net. > . 45003 IN NS i.root-servers.net. > . 45003 IN NS a.root-servers.net. > . 45003 IN NS d.root-servers.net. > . 45003 IN NS f.root-servers.net. > . 45003 IN NS k.root-servers.net. > ;; Received 508 bytes from 192.168.0.33#53(192.168.0.33) in 21 ms > > net. 172800 IN NS e.gtld-servers.net. > net. 172800 IN NS m.gtld-servers.net. > net. 172800 IN NS f.gtld-servers.net. > net. 172800 IN NS a.gtld-servers.net. > net. 172800 IN NS l.gtld-servers.net. > net. 172800 IN NS b.gtld-servers.net. > net. 172800 IN NS j.gtld-servers.net. > net. 172800 IN NS c.gtld-servers.net. > net. 172800 IN NS d.gtld-servers.net. > net. 172800 IN NS h.gtld-servers.net. > net. 172800 IN NS k.gtld-servers.net. > net. 172800 IN NS g.gtld-servers.net. > net. 172800 IN NS i.gtld-servers.net. > ;; Received 509 bytes from 2001:7fe::53#53(2001:7fe::53) in 43 ms > > clamav.net. 172800 IN NS ns3.clamav.net. > clamav.net. 172800 IN NS ns4.clamav.net. > clamav.net. 172800 IN NS ns7.clamav.net. > clamav.net. 172800 IN NS ns6.clamav.net. > clamav.net. 172800 IN NS ns4a.clamav.net. > clamav.net. 172800 IN NS ns1a.clamav.net. > ;; Received 302 bytes from 192.42.93.30#53(192.42.93.30) in 44 ms > > current.cvd.clamav.net. 1800 IN TXT > "0.99.2:57:22593:1479972755:1:63:45272:285" > cvd.clamav.net. 7200 IN NS ns3.clamav.net. > cvd.clamav.net. 7200 IN NS ns4.clamav.net. > cvd.clamav.net. 7200 IN NS ns5.clamav.net. > cvd.clamav.net. 7200 IN NS ns6.clamav.net. > cvd.clamav.net. 7200 IN NS ns7.clamav.net. > ;; Received 184 bytes from 2a01:4f8:160:8421::2#53(2a01:4f8:160:8421::2) in > 38 ms > > > Naturally it would be wasteful if the resolver did all these lookups every > time, so it stores all the results it gets back in a local cache. So next > time you lookup the same answer, it already has it. If you lookup a different > .net address, it already knows which servers handle .net. And so on. > > So what is the TTL value ? > Put simply, it's the maximum time your resolver should cache the record for. > It doesn't mean the record should disappear, only that the resolver should > discard it's cached copy after that time. > > As Dennis says, if you ask your local resolver repeatedly, you'll see the TTL > value dropping - this is the time remaining before the resolver must discard > the record. Once that time drops to zero, the record is removed from the > cache. Next time you look it up, the resolver must go and ask the question > again to get the current answer. > It will use whatever results it still has in the cache to shorten the > sequence needed - so we can see here that the .net NS records have a TTL > value of 2 days because they aren't going to change very often, and it means > our local resolver should never need to go and ask the root servers for them > more than once every two days. > At the other extreme, the TXT for current.cvd.clamav.net is just half an hour > - because it changes frequently and we want users to get the new value > reasonably quickly. Depending on timing, users will see a lag between 0 and > 1800s between the record changing and when they see the new value. > > Oh yes, and TTL values can be set globally for each zone, and also on a per > record basis. > > So you can lookup a record as often as you like, but it won't actually change > more often that the TTL length. Eg, you could lookup the > current.cvd.clamav.net value every minute - but it'll only change when that > 1/2 hour TTL expires. > > > Here's the result of doing the same lookup a short time apart (without the > +trace option).
